Some images of Party and State leaders visiting President Ho Chi Minh's Mausoleum

On the morning of April 29, 2025, on the occasion of the 50th anniversary of the Liberation of the South and National Reunification Day (April 30, 1975 - April 30, 2025), a delegation of leaders and former leaders of the Party and State came to lay wreaths and visit President Ho Chi Minh's Mausoleum, and lay wreaths at the Monument to Heroic Martyrs.
